This is a problem I have sometimes. When updates are available, use the
Red Hat Network Alert Icon under Apps ---> System Tools. Double click
on the icon (it should be red with an !) to see what's for update.
Close the window without doing anything, then reboot the machine
(sometimes this problem is caused by leaving the machine on too long)
and once you're back in Linux, head to the Terminal (also under System
Tools) then become root by typing su plus your password.
Type yum update and it should work.
Let me know if this doesn't - there are other solutions besides this
one, but this is the one to try first.
